Fees and Cost Over Time

AVOS charges 0.64% per year while IVV charges 0.03%. On a $10,000 position that is $64 vs $3 annually, a gap of $61 per year that compounds over a long holding period. On income, AVOS currently yields 0.00% against 1.10% for IVV.

Holdings Overlap

22.3%overlap

AVOS and IVV share 52 holdings out of 627 unique holdings combined, representing a 22.3% weight overlap.

Moderate overlap means holding both could provide meaningful diversification benefits.
